Is Travel Ruining Your Ability To Lose Weight?

Having to leave your familiar and predictable environment can really set you back in terms of progress. After all, something as simple as finding healthy food can be very hard when you are on the road.

The good news here is that travel doesn’t have to put a dent in your efforts.

So here are 6 strategies for maintaining your physique while on the road:

1. Work your body at least once every seven days: At a bare minimum you want to exercise once every two weeks. However, if you can train once every seven days you will prevent any loss in gains. You see, after two weeks of inactivity you will begin to lose muscle.

2. Don’t stop eating frequently: You need to keep on eating every couple of hours to prevent your metabolism from slowing down because of muscle mass loss. The main adjustment you want to make is to reduce the size of each meal and to reduce carbohydrate intake.

3. Get some high resistance bands: Not only are these bands very durable, but they can also apply a lot of resistance to your muscles. The key here is to make sure they are heavy duty. Otherwise, regular bands will not provide the necessary stimulus.

4. If possible, get a suspension trainer: Suspension trainers are expensive, and I also believe that they are grossly overhyped. Having said that, they are extremely portable. So they can be a good option when you are on the go.

5. Do total body workouts: You need to work all your big muscles when you are on the road. This is the only way to make sure you don’t lose muscle mass. Otherwise, your metabolism will begin to slow down big time. So do standard movements like presses, rows and squats.

6. Make the necessary adjustments: If you are going to be moving around less then slightly restrict caloric intake. If you are tired and jet lagged reduce the amount of weight you use in the gym. Try to avoid injury here and stay healthy.

Travel can be a blessing or a curse on your body. So take heed of the advice in this article to make sure your body doesn’t regress when you are on the road!

Why You Should Choose A Good Pedometer

Walking is a great exercise for getting in shape, losing weight and achieving a whole host of major health benefits. It’s a low impact workout that doesn’t require any special equipment, training or expertise. You can do it just about anywhere – there’s no need to visit the gym – which means that there are no expensive monthly membership fees either. You can slot it into your daily schedule whenever it’s most convenient for you. Do it in one session or break it into a number of shorter sessions between other activities. It’s entirely up to you.

One item of essential walking equipment is a comfortable pair of shoes or boots. If your shoes give you blisters or cause you discomfort, then it will be difficult to motivate yourself to keep up with your walking workout program. So be sure that you have a good fitting, comfortable pair. If you like, you could get some of the latest designs of fitness shoes which help to raise the amount of work that your lower body muscles perform whilst walking normally.

There is a wide range of different brands to choose from on the market – Skechers Shape Ups, Reeboks Easy Tones, Fit flops exercise sandals and Masai Barefoot Technology are amongst the best known and most popular – but there are new brands appearing on the market all the time. They do have some slight differences, but the common thread running through the various designs seems to be a specially designed sole which raises the amount of work performed by the muscles in your legs and butt. This increases the effectiveness of your workout and helps you to get the maximum return from your walking schedule.

Most health professionals seem to suggest that should be aiming for 10,000 steps a day on a regular basis in order to achieve all of the various health benefits. Many people find that wearing a pedometer can be a useful motivational aid to help them add more steps into their day and get closer to the target figure. Pedometers are not expensive these days but, if you think that a pedometer would help you to stay motivated you should be certain to get a reasonably good quality model.

A recent study found that a high percentage of pedometers were inaccurate – by as much as 50% in some cases. It seemed that inaccurate pedometers tended to overestimate the number of steps – meaning that someone who was walking for 5,000 paces daily might be under the false impression that they were reaching their 10,000 step target. This is because the cheaper pedometers generally use hairspring technology which is factory calibrated during the manufacturing process. These generally become less and less accurate as the pedometer ages – with an ever increasing tendency to overestimate the number of steps taken being in evidence.

Better models employ coiled spring technology and dual accelerometer sensors which means that they have greater accuracy, a longer lifespan and that they can be carried in your pocket or a bag instead of being worn on your belt. An Omron pedometer typically has an accuracy of plus or minus 5%. Other quality brands include Yamax, Taneka and New Lifestyles.

Should you wish to find out just how accurate your pedometer is, there are two very simple tests which you can perform. The first is to simply count out 100 steps and compare it with what your pedometer has recorded. The second test method is to take a note of the reading on your pedometer just before you first sit down – at your desk at work perhaps – and then to check it again after being seated for thirty minutes or so. If it rises significantly due to your normal movements whilst seated then it will overestimate your step count.

Nowadays, most pedometers are of the digital variety. They usually have a memory and you can generally see your results for 7 days – useful if you want to monitor your progress. Some even allow you to load your results into your computer using a USB connection so that you can monitor your results over time. You can choose how your results are displayed as well. Choose from the number of steps, the distance covered or the number of calories burned – whichever helps you to keep motivated.

How To Get Rid Of Abdominal Fat Fast!

If you’re goal is to lose weight in the new year or build a strong set of abs, then discovering the right combination of diet and exercise is important to your success. There are a number of ways to reduce fat and show off your midsection. In this article I’ll reveal the specific techniques that have worked for me and can work for you too. Show off your abdominal muscles by applying simple yet highly effective techniques.

Getting your body healthy can be difficult for a number of people. Imagining yourself in a gym with lots of people or managing a hectic schedule that doesn’t allow for time to do your exercise can seem a bit overwhelming. The good news is that having strong abdominal muscles doesn’t have to take a long time. Just ten to fifteen minutes per day of abdominal exercises can go a long way.

Unlike other muscle groups like your back or hamstrings, ab muscles can be stressed on a daily basis. This is good news because it means that if we apply the correct exercises regularly we’ll see results. When you work your abs daily you don’t have to place a large amount of stress on the muscles, just use them. The key is to use a full range of motion. I’ll show you the exercises you can do easily to accomplish this goal.

Abdominal crunches are still a great way to improve your abdominal muscles. Crunches work the upper abs and work deep into your muscles. Some individuals believe that abdominal crunches are no longer effective but they work well if done properly. Crunches are best done lying on a flat surface. Start the exercise by clasping your hands gently behind your neck. Lift your feet off the floor and make sure your thighs are at a ninety degree angle to the floor. Look up and raise your torso up towards the ceiling. Try to complete ten repetitions and work up to three sets.

One of my favorite exercises is the called the hanging leg raise. It’s easy to build ab muscles when you are using a full range of motion. This exercise is simple to learn and uses your core abdominal muscles. Begin by hanging from a bar or door frame with adequate clearance so your feet are off the ground. Very slowly raise your knees to your chest and pause for one second. Then slowly lower your legs to the starting position. It may take some time for you to do ten repetitions. Once you accomplish that goal, slowly build up to three sets of ten.

Once you have mastered exercises like crunches and hanging raises to build your abdominal muscles, the next step is to focus on reducing overall body fat. The best way to do this is to build muscle and do aerobic exercise. Aerobic exercise comes in a variety of forms such as running, jogging, biking, etc. Regardless of which method you choose, running or biking approximately three days a week should do the trick. Focus on aerobic exercises to reduce fat around your stomach and your body as a whole.

Getting the abdominal muscles you have always wanted is simple. Start with the right exercises like crunches and hanging leg raises. Add aerobic exercise to your fitness routine and you’ll see your body fat start to melt away. Although we didn’t discuss diet in great detail, adhering to a diet that is rich in fruits and vegetables as well as low in saturated fat will go a long way in helping you achieve the six pack you’ve always wanted.

Benefits Of An Exercise Bike

There are so many home exercise equipments for losing weight but the most popular is the stationary bike. It is user friendly and light. In addition, a lot of these stationary bicycles are easily folded away for storage.

Training on an exercise bike can be combined with other exercises such as pushups. Say you ride your bike for forty minutes then tone the rest of your body like the muscles in your arms by following up with other exercises. Devise a routine on how you want to do your different exercises. You can interchange them to make them less repetitive. First select the exercise you will do on a daily basis. If you start with the exercise bike training on the first day, on another day start with pushups followed by your bike riding exercise and so on.

Using the stationary bike is definitely a great way to conveniently exercise in the comfort of your own home. Not only do you have privacy, but you also control your schedule.

Training in a gym by using barbells, doing pushups, running, walking, or riding outdoors are equally as intense as training on an exercise bike. They are all meant for the same purpose and that is to keep you fit. It’s a matter of setting a goal and maintaining it. You have the freehand of choosing which method best suits you. All of them require concentration and determination on your part.

Every type of training begins with warm-ups. By doing light exercises, you set the pace for yourself and eventually build the momentum as you go.

Exercise bike training does not necessarily limit you to exercising at home. You can join various exercise clubs. This will make training more fun and interesting since you will be interacting with people as well. When training with an exercise bike you don’t need to concentrate a lot. It allows you to exercise and at the same time have a great conversation with your fellow trainee. Before you know it, you have been riding for an hour. This is just one of the advantages of training with an exercise bike.

Proven Exercises To Enhance Your Fitness

Get fit with the help of today’s leading advice on fitness and nutrition. With so many diet and exercise routines, it’s hard to know what to do and how to do it. In order to achieve your physical goals, we need to discuss lifestyle habits and what you’re doing to move in the direction of your goals.

Achieving a strong set of abdominal muscles requires a comprehensive approach to diet and exercise. Either one in and of itself will not prove effective. In fact, even if you have some success, it will be limited or only last for a very short while. The key is creating healthy habits that can sustain you over the long-term.

Begin with a clear picture of what you want. More often than not health and fitness routines are not successful because the goal of your effort is not well defined. Once you have a clear goal, you can continually evaluate your actions to determine if you’re moving closer or farther away from achieving your desired outcome.

Once you have a goal, focus on that goal daily. Imagine yourself as already having achieved your goal and picture it in your mind. Feel the feelings of having the body you want. Strong abdominal muscles and lean muscle mass can be yours with the proper focus and desire.

After getting clear about what you want and thinking about it on a regular basis, you are ready to put into practice the best tips and strategies for achieving the outcome you desire. This happens through a combination of diet and exercise and can easy be seen by modeling those who have already achieved success in the area of health and fitness.

The first step is to focus on fueling your body. Are you consuming foods that are high in protein and low in saturated fat? By consuming high amounts of protein, your body can repair itself quickly. This is important for building muscle. The more muscle you build and leaner you become. Muscle helps to burn fat. This keeps you feeling and looking good.

The second step is to exercise on a regular basis. If you exercise frequently you can burn excess calories and tone your body. You don’t need to overdue it on the exercise. In fact this is where there is usually a huge breakdown. Exercising an hour or more per day every day isn’t sustainable. Shoot for 3 to 4 times per week for 30 minutes. This is enough to get you in shape.

By focusing on your goal and getting a clear picture of what you want, it’s easy to start moving in the right direction. Add the combination of proper nutrition and exercise and you will find yourself getting stronger and healthier. Make proper nutrition and exercise a habit and you’re sure to see lasting results.
